对象存储的访问方式,深入解析对象存储COS公有读对象的访问链接格式
- 综合资讯
- 2024-11-29 12:02:07
- 1

对象存储COS公有读对象访问链接格式解析:对象存储服务COS提供公有读访问链接,支持通过链接直接访问对象。链接格式包含桶名称、对象键、访问签名等元素,确保数据安全与高效...
对象存储COS公有读对象访问链接格式解析:对象存储服务COS提供公有读访问链接,支持通过链接直接访问对象。链接格式包含桶名称、对象键、访问签名等元素,确保数据安全与高效访问。
随着互联网技术的飞速发展,数据存储需求日益增长,对象存储(Object Storage)作为一种新兴的存储技术,因其简单、高效、可扩展等特点,逐渐成为企业级数据存储的首选,COS(Cloud Object Storage)作为腾讯云的对象存储服务,为广大用户提供了一种安全、可靠、易用的存储解决方案,本文将深入解析COS公有读对象的访问链接格式,帮助用户更好地理解和使用COS服务。
COS公有读对象概述
COS公有读对象指的是用户在COS存储桶中存储的公开可访问的对象,这些对象可以通过公网访问,无需权限验证,COS公有读对象广泛应用于网站图片、视频、文件下载等场景。
COS公有读对象访问链接格式
COS公有读对象的访问链接格式如下:
https://[BucketName]-[Region].cos[.cn|-.myqcloud.com]/[ObjectKey]
各参数的含义如下:
1、BucketName:存储桶名称,由用户自定义,用于区分不同的存储桶。
2、Region:存储桶所在的地域,ap-shanghai、ap-beijing-1等。
3、cos:固定域名,表示访问的是COS服务。
4、.cn或-.myqcloud.com:表示访问的是COS中国大陆或海外节点。
5、ObjectKey:对象键,用于标识存储桶中的对象,由用户自定义。
COS公有读对象访问链接示例
以下是一个COS公有读对象访问链接的示例:
https://examplebucket-1251000004.cos.ap-shanghai.myqcloud.com/exampleobject.jpg
在这个示例中:
- BucketName为examplebucket
- Region为ap-shanghai
- cos为cos
- .myqcloud.com表示访问的是COS海外节点
- ObjectKey为exampleobject.jpg
COS公有读对象访问权限设置
在COS中,用户可以通过设置访问权限来控制公有读对象的访问,以下是COS提供的几种访问权限设置方式:
1、设置CORS策略:CORS(Cross-Origin Resource Sharing,跨源资源共享)策略允许用户自定义跨源请求的响应头和允许的来源,从而实现跨域访问。
2、设置防盗链:防盗链功能可以防止他人通过盗用链接的方式直接访问您的存储桶中的对象。
3、设置匿名访问:匿名访问允许所有用户(包括未登录用户)访问存储桶中的对象。
4、设置IP白名单:IP白名单功能允许用户指定允许访问存储桶的IP地址范围。
COS公有读对象访问限制
虽然COS公有读对象允许公网访问,但为了保障数据安全和用户体验,以下几种情况会对访问进行限制:
1、存储桶访问策略:在COS控制台中设置存储桶访问策略,可以限制存储桶中对象的访问权限。
2、存储桶权限:存储桶权限分为私有、公开读、公开读写三种,用户可以根据需求设置合适的权限。
3、对象访问策略:用户可以为存储桶中的对象设置访问策略,限制其访问权限。
本文深入解析了COS公有读对象的访问链接格式,并介绍了COS公有读对象的访问权限设置和访问限制,通过本文的学习,用户可以更好地理解和使用COS服务,实现高效、安全的数据存储和访问。
本文链接:https://www.zhitaoyun.cn/1181403.html
发表评论